Customized Lotus Esprit: Type: Wet sub: Length: 14 feet (4.3 m) Beam: 6 feet (1.8 m) Height: 4 feet (1.2 m) Propulsion: 4 electric motors: Capacity: 2: Crew: 2 "Wet Nellie" is the behind-the-scenes name given to a custom-built submarine, created for the 1977 James Bond film The Spy Who Loved Me in the shape of a Lotus Esprit S1 sports car.

The Lotus Esprit is a rear mid-engine, rear-wheel-drive sports car built by Lotus Cars at their Hethel, England factory, from 1976 to 2004.Together with the Lotus Elise / Exige, it is one of Lotus' most long-lived models.. In the mid-1970s, the Lotus Esprit S1 was a modern car for a modern Bond. The Lotus Esprit S1 ranked as one of car designer Giorgetto Giugiaro's origami-style 'folded paper' designs. The car was originally named the Kiwi before being changed to Esprit in keeping with Lotus' lineup of car model names beginning with the letter 'e'.
